How to Prepare Cream Cheese Mints

Making cream cheese mints is quite simple. With just a few easy steps, you will have a delightful batch ready to enjoy. First, gather your ingredients, and then let’s get started!

Ingredients:

To make cream cheese mints, you will need the following ingredients:

  • 8 oz cream cheese, softened
  • 4 cups powdered sugar
  • 1 tsp peppermint extract (or any flavor you prefer)
  • Food coloring (optional)
  • Granulated sugar for coating (optional)

Instructions:

Follow these steps to create your delicious cream cheese mints:


  1. Soften the Cream Cheese: Make sure your cream cheese is at room temperature. This will help it blend smoothly with the sugar.



  2. Mix Ingredients: In a large bowl, combine the softened cream cheese, powdered sugar, and peppermint extract. Mix well until the ingredients are thoroughly combined and form a thick dough. You can use an electric mixer or mix by hand.



  3. Add Food Coloring (optional): If you want to add color to your mints, this is the time to add a few drops of food coloring. Mix until the color is even throughout the dough.



  4. Shape the Mints: Take small amounts of the mixture and roll them into tiny balls or press them into candy molds. If you prefer small mints, aim for about 1 inch in size.



  5. Coat with Sugar (optional): Roll the shaped mints in granulated sugar for a sweet and crunchy outer layer if you desire.



  6. Chill: Place the mints on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Chill them in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es to firm them up.



  7. Serve and Enjoy: Once chilled, your delicious cream cheese mints are ready to be enjoyed!

How to Store Cream Cheese Mints

To keep your cream cheese mints fresh, store them in an airtight container. Here are some tips for storage:

  • Refrigerate: Keep the mints in the refrigerator, especially if you live in a warm climate. They will stay fresh for about 2 weeks.
  • Freeze: For longer storage, you can freeze the mints. Just place them in an airtight container or freezer bag, and they can last up to 3 months. To serve, just let them thaw in the refrigerator.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. Can I use low-fat cream cheese?

Yes, you can use low-fat cream cheese, but it may affect the texture slightly. The mints may not be as creamy, but they will still taste good.

2. How long do these mints last?

If stored properly in an airtight container in the refrigerator, cream cheese mints can last for about 2 weeks. In the freezer, they can last up to 3 months.

3. Can I make these mints without an electric mixer?

Yes! You can make these mints by hand using a spatula or a wooden spoon. It may take a bit more effort to combine the ingredients, but it is entirely doable.

4. Our cream cheese mints suitable for kids?

Absolutely! Cream cheese mints are a delightful treat for kids. Just be cautious with the flavoring if the children do not like strong mint flavors.

5. Can I store the mints at room temperature?

It is best to store cream cheese mints in the refrigerator due to their cream cheese content. However, you can leave them out at room temperature for a short time when serving.
